we already have (not well documented) tags for this:
Either you use destination_sign relations as Sarah pointed out. Or, if
you prefer a more simple approach, there are eight defined keys to add
the information with approximate directions:
direction_north, ..., direction_southwest, direction_northeast, ...
For some reason they are only mentioned on the German Wiki page
https://wiki.openstreetmap.org/wiki/DE:Tag:information%3Dguidepost
But they are used almost 30,000 times already, see e.g.
https://taginfo.openstreetmap.org/keys/direction_south
These eight cardinal directions seem to be quite imprecise, but if you
look at common intersections, they are able to cover almost all cases.
